OSWEGO, N.Y. – Oswego scored four goals by four different players, one in each quarter, to defeat the Elmira Soaring Eagles by a score of 4-0. The Lakers push their record out to 6-2 on the season.
THE BASICS
- Final Score: Oswego 4, Elmira 0
- Location: Pine Valley, N.Y.
- Records: Oswego 6-2, Elmira 0-5
HOW IT HAPPENED
- Junior Kaitlyn Mastracco scored her team-leading tenth goal of the season at 10:08 of the first quarter on an assist from Leah Romanowski.
- Senior Alyssa DeMichael scored late in the second quarter on an assist from Mastracco.
- Romanowski put in her first goal of the season shortly into the second half with the assist to Abby Testo.
- Sophomore Abigail Redmond finished the scoring in the fourth quarter from an Ellie Kazel assist.
- The Lakers dominated possession with a 27-1 edge in shots and a 16-1 advantage in penalty corners.
